Kathy Caprino, M.A. is a nationally recognized women's work-life expert, career and executive coach, speaker, and author of the new book Breakdown, Breakthrough: The Professional Woman’s Guide to Claiming a Life of Passion, Power, and Purpose (Berrett-Koehler, Nov. 2008, see Breakdown Breakthrough).  Kathy is also Founder/President of Ellia Communications - a executive and leadership coaching and consulting organization dedicated to helping professional women advance and achieve greater success, fulfillment and reward in their professional lives.

A Forbes contributor and frequent invited speaker and writer on career issues and trends, Kathy's work has appeared in over 100 leading publications and magazines, and on national TV.  Her book reveals the key findings from her yearlong national research study identifying the 12 "hidden" challenges of professional women, and presents a 3-step holistic guide for overcoming these crises.

Ellia Communications offers top-level executive coaching, and career and leadership training programs designed to provide a much needed forum to help professionals address real-life challenges, navigate successfully through transition and change, and reach their highest potential for success and advancement.
